What Is a Sitemap and Why It Matters

A sitemap is an XML file that lists all important URLs of your website, helping search engines like Google and Bing understand your site’s structure. It tells crawlers when pages were last updated, how often they change, and which pages are most important. Without a sitemap, search engines may miss some of your content, especially if your website is new or has low authority.

Key Benefits of a Sitemap

  • Ensures faster discovery and indexing of new posts.
  • Improves crawl efficiency for large or complex blogs.
  • Helps Google identify recently updated content.
  • Boosts visibility in Google News, Discover, and Search results.

Common Sitemap Mistakes to Avoid

  • Including URLs that return 404 or redirect errors.
  • Duplicate or thin content pages.
  • Forgetting to regenerate sitemap after adding new posts.
  • Wrong date formats (Google ignores invalid lastmod fields).

FAQs – Frequently Asked Questions

1. Is submitting a sitemap mandatory for Google?

No, but it’s highly recommended. A sitemap helps Google discover new pages much faster, especially for new or small blogs.

2. How often should I update my sitemap?

Ideally, regenerate your sitemap every time you publish new posts or major updates. Our generator makes this effortless — just click and download again.

3. Can I include images in my sitemap?

Yes! For media-rich blogs, you can extend the XML structure to include image entries using the image:image tag for better visibility in Google Images.
